Lioness 1,455 Posted October 13, 2013 plenty logistical problems as well chucks. It may 'only' be 30 miles but transport links are almost non existant on a Sunday. For those on public transport you would probably be looking at them getting in to Glasgow (a lot seem to be from the south side), train or bus to Edinburgh centre then train out to Bathgate or if you are very lucky bus to Armadale. Those getting the train to Bathgate have a good 2-3 mile walk/taxi after that. Then the same in reverse at the end of a meeting, all on Sunday service. cyclone 943 Posted October 13, 2013 Did that apply in the Dale Devil days ? Apparently was a stipulation added later at one of the three year renewals . The three year renewal has now been dropped but as far as I am aware the time & weekly restrictions still apply.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
